package org.apache.xml.security.utils.resolver.implementations;
import org.apache.xml.security.signature.XMLSignatureInput;
import org.apache.xml.security.utils.XMLUtils;
import org.apache.xml.security.utils.resolver.ResourceResolverContext;
import org.apache.xml.security.utils.resolver.ResourceResolverException;
import org.apache.xml.security.utils.resolver.ResourceResolverSpi;
import org.w3c.dom.Document;
import org.w3c.dom.Element;
import org.w3c.dom.Node;
/**
* This resolver is used for resolving same-document URIs like URI="" of URI="#id".
*
* @see <A HREF="http://www.w3.org/TR/xmldsig-core/#sec-ReferenceProcessingModel">The Reference processing model in the XML Signature spec</A>
* @see <A HREF="http://www.w3.org/TR/xmldsig-core/#sec-Same-Document">Same-Document URI-References in the XML Signature spec</A>
* @see <A HREF="http://www.ietf.org/rfc/rfc2396.txt">Section 4.2 of RFC 2396</A>
*/
public class ResolverFragment extends ResourceResolverSpi {
private static final org.slf4j.Logger LOG =
org.slf4j.LoggerFactory.getLogger(ResolverFragment.class);
@Override
public boolean engineIsThreadSafe() {
return true;
}
/**
* {@inheritDoc}
*/
@Override
public XMLSignatureInput engineResolveURI(ResourceResolverContext context)
throws ResourceResolverException {
Document doc = context.attr.getOwnerElement().getOwnerDocument();
Node selectedElem = null;
if (context.uriToResolve.equals("")) {
/*
* Identifies the node-set (minus any comment nodes) of the XML
* resource containing the signature
*/
LOG.debug("ResolverFragment with empty URI (means complete document)");
selectedElem = doc;
} else {
/*
* URI="#chapter1"
* Identifies a node-set containing the element with ID attribute
* value 'chapter1' of the XML resource containing the signature.
* XML Signature (and its applications) modify this node-set to
* include the element plus all descendants including namespaces and
* attributes -- but not comments.
*/
String id = context.uriToResolve.substring(1);
selectedElem = doc.getElementById(id);
if (selectedElem == null) {
Object exArgs[] = { id };
throw new ResourceResolverException(
"signature.Verification.MissingID", exArgs, context.uriToResolve, context.baseUri
);
}
if (context.secureValidation) {
Element start = context.attr.getOwnerDocument().getDocumentElement();
if (!XMLUtils.protectAgainstWrappingAttack(start, id)) {
Object exArgs[] = { id };
throw new ResourceResolverException(
"signature.Verification.MultipleIDs", exArgs, context.uriToResolve, context.baseUri
);
}
}
LOG.debug(
"Try to catch an Element with ID {} and Element was {}", id, selectedElem
);
}
XMLSignatureInput result = new XMLSignatureInput(selectedElem);
result.setSecureValidation(context.secureValidation);
result.setExcludeComments(true);
result.setMIMEType("text/xml");
if (context.baseUri != null && context.baseUri.length() > 0) {
result.setSourceURI(context.baseUri.concat(context.uriToResolve));
} else {
result.setSourceURI(context.uriToResolve);
}
return result;
}
/**
* Method engineCanResolve
* {@inheritDoc}
* @param context
*/
public boolean engineCanResolveURI(ResourceResolverContext context) {
if (context.uriToResolve == null) {
LOG.debug("Quick fail for null uri");
return false;
}
if (context.uriToResolve.equals("") ||
context.uriToResolve.charAt(0) == '#' && !context.uriToResolve.startsWith("#xpointer(")
) {
LOG.debug("State I can resolve reference: \"{}\"", context.uriToResolve);
return true;
}
LOG.debug("Do not seem to be able to resolve reference: \"{}\"", context.uriToResolve);
return false;
}
}
